AWS Announces Three Serverless Innovations to Help Customers Analyze and Manage Data at Any Scale

AWS (Amazon Web Services) recently announced three new serverless innovations that aim to help customers effectively analyze and manage data at any scale. These new tools offer a range of capabilities that simplify data management and empower businesses to make more informed decisions based on actionable insights. Let’s take a closer look at each innovation and how it can benefit organizations.

1. AWS Glue Elastic Views

AWS Glue Elastic Views is a powerful solution that allows customers to create materialized views across different data stores. It eliminates the need for manual data copying and synchronization by automatically updating the views whenever the underlying data changes. With Glue Elastic Views, businesses can easily combine and analyze data from various sources in real-time, enabling faster decision-making and improved data-driven strategies.

This innovation is particularly beneficial for organizations that deal with large volumes of data across multiple systems. By providing a unified view of data, Glue Elastic Views simplifies the data management process and reduces complexity, resulting in improved operational efficiency and cost savings.

Additionally, Glue Elastic Views integrates seamlessly with other AWS services such as Amazon Redshift, Amazon Athena, and Amazon EMR, allowing customers to leverage existing infrastructure and maximize the value of their data assets.

2. AWS Glue DataBrew

AWS Glue DataBrew is a visual data preparation service that enables customers to clean and transform data without writing code. With its intuitive interface and built-in data quality checks, DataBrew simplifies the data preparation process and accelerates time-to-insight. Users can easily explore, profile, and manipulate data using over 250 built-in transformations, making it easier to identify and address data issues.

DataBrew also provides a collaborative environment where multiple users can work on data preparation projects simultaneously. It ensures data consistency and allows teams to work efficiently, improving overall productivity.

By providing a no-code solution for data preparation, AWS Glue DataBrew empowers business users with limited technical skills to access and analyze data independently. This democratization of data enables organizations to foster a data-driven culture and drive innovation across departments.

3. Amazon Managed Service for Grafana (AMG)

Amazon Managed Service for Grafana (AMG) is a fully managed and secure service that simplifies the visualization of operational data from multiple sources. With AMG, customers can easily analyze and monitor diverse data sets using pre-built dashboards and visualizations. The service seamlessly integrates with AWS data sources such as Amazon CloudWatch, Amazon Elasticsearch, and AWS IoT SiteWise, enabling businesses to gain real-time insights into their operations.

AMG simplifies the deployment and management of Grafana, an open-source platform for data visualization, by automating time-consuming tasks such as software updates and patching. This allows customers to focus on deriving value from their data rather than managing infrastructure.

Furthermore, AMG offers enhanced security features such as encryption, access control, and network isolation, ensuring the confidentiality and integrity of data. This makes it an ideal solution for organizations that handle sensitive information and need robust security measures in place.
